“…There is precedent for such strong, temporally spaced stimuli to activate specific intracellular signaling pathways (Wu et al, 2001). Furthermore both the pattern and frequency of stimulation and ensuing Ca 2ϩ transients can regulate neuronal gene expression (Dolmetsch et al, 1997;Itoh et al, 1997;Watt et al, 2000). Thus, the frequency of the bursting episodes may be the critical variable to which motoneurons are responding.…”
